Romans 12:21
Do not be overcome by evil, but overcome evil with good.
Life frequently challenges us with moments when evil seems to have the upper hand. Whether the source is the quiet whisper of temptation, the sting of another person’s wrongdoing, or the old resentments that linger in our hearts, there is a persistent pressure to respond in kind—to hit back, to defend our pride, or to brood over hurts (Ephesians 6:11). But Scripture invites us to a far different path: “Do not be overcome by evil, but overcome evil with good” (Romans 12:21).

It’s easy to forget that behind every personal conflict, there is a deeper struggle at work. The enemy, Satan, seeks to fan the flames of anger and push us toward revenge, hoping that we’ll give in to our lower natures (James 4:7). But the call to “put on the whole armor of God” means we guard ourselves—not with sharp words or grudges, but with truth, faith, and prayer. If we resist the urge to retaliate, if we refuse to repay injury with injury, then evil doesn’t win; we gain a freedom the world cannot take away (2 Peter 2:19).
When we answer hatred with kindness—feeding the hungry, offering help to someone who has hurt us, or choosing words that heal instead of wound—we are not just avoiding the cycle of revenge. Rather, we are overcoming evil by drawing on the strength and love Christ Himself has shown us (Romans 8:37). Sometimes kindness softens those who oppose us; sometimes it changes us, making us more like Christ. Either way, choosing good is not weakness, but victory—a mark of being “more than conquerors” because He is with us.
So, take courage. You are not left alone to fight bitterness and pain by your own strength. God gives the grace, the wisdom, and the power to rise above it—overcoming evil, not by force, but by reflecting the goodness of the One who has already overcome for us.
